Short engine
Part Number : 95810093403$37,744.67
Short engine 95810093403 958.100.934.03 958 100 934 03 read more
Short engine 95810093403 958.100.934.03 958 100 934 03
Description
Short engine 95810093403 958.100.934.03 958 100 934 03
$37,744.67
Short engine 95810093403 958.100.934.03 958 100 934 03 read more
Short engine 95810093403 958.100.934.03 958 100 934 03
Description
Short engine 95810093403 958.100.934.03 958 100 934 03